Good morning and welcome to our live coverage of the 2025 Tokyo World Championships women’s marathon.
Follow Our WhatsApp Channel For More News
At exactly 1:30am on Sunday, the starter’s gun will echo through the streets of Tokyo as the world’s best distance runners battle for the prestigious 42km world title.
Kenya’s hopes will rest on Olympic champion Peres Jepchirchir, who etched her name in history with gold in Sapporo at the 2021 Games.
She leads a formidable trio that also features Rotterdam Marathon champion Jackline Cherono and Frankfurt Marathon runner-up Magdalyne Masai.
With such firepower on the start line, Kenya is once again chasing top honors in the Japanese capital.
